[QUOTE]Originally posted by MinutiaeMan: [QB] Okay, the idea of Republicans and Democrats twisting around the proposed funding numbers to blame the other side is certainly plausible, probably even likely. (Not to mention that the Congressmen are hardly a single bloc, or even two blocs... so there's all sorts of agendas flying around.) However, the FBI agent cutback seems completely antithetical to everything that the Bush administration has been telling us for the past year and a half. I don't understand how lowering our vigilance can be a good thing... I guess this goes back to Bush's attempts to juggle three separate issues, and each of his three policies are wholly incompatible. 1. International cooperation against terrorism. Requires multilateral effort. (Duh!) 2. Military policy, especially against Iraq. Also requires multilateral effort, and requires increased funding to support military activity. 3. Fostering economic recovery through tax cuts of dubious focus while simultaneously increasing spending and forcing the burden on state governments. Anyone else see the contradictions here?
